amazon-game-downloads.jpgAmazon.co.uk will now support digital game and software downloads, letting you directly download and install your purchases from the site immediately after check out.

Over 600 titles have already been added, including Tomb Raider, Far Cry 3, The Sims 3, Borderlands 2 and Mass Effect 3. There’s also a dedicated free-to-play store (www.amazon.co.uk/freetoplay), where gamers can grab the likes of Stronghold Kingdoms and Second Life.

If you’re not much of a gamer, Amazon will also be offering software downloads including Microsoft Office, Adobe Photoshop, anti-virus and security products from Norton and Kaspersky, business software from Sage and language learning software from Rosetta Stone.

The store also includes Steam-like backup and storage in a cloud-based digital library, meaning all your games can be downloaded to other machines as many times as each product license allows for. Pre-orders are also supported, while product codes for other services such as Origin, Xbox LIVE or Microsoft Office.com can also be bought and redeemed seperately at the relevant digital store,

“Customers buying software and video games who want their products quickly can now download these products straight to their computer with the click of a button.” said Xavier Garambois, Vice-President, European Consumer Business at Amazon EU S.à.r.l.

“Not only is this exciting for everyday purchases but for major upcoming releases, Amazon customers will be able to get their hands on products without waiting for them to arrive in the post.”
